What is Alprazolam?

Xanax (Alprazolam) is a prescription benzodiazepine used for anxiety and panic disorders. It works by calming the central nervous system to reduce excessive activity. This medication is taken orally and requires careful use under medical supervision. Always follow healthcare provider instructions when using Xanax.

What is Alprazolam used for?

Xanax is commonly prescribed to manage symptoms of generalized anxiety disorder and panic disorder. It may also be used short-term for anxiety associated with depression. Patients often ask, 'what is Xanax used for' as it helps reduce overwhelming worry and tension. It is not intended for everyday stress or long-term use without medical oversight.

What does Alprazolam interact with?

Alcohol and other central nervous system depressants can increase drowsiness when taken with Xanax. Certain medications, including some antidepressants and antifungals, may affect how Xanax works. Always inform your healthcare provider about all prescription, over-the-counter, and herbal products you use. Avoid grapefruit products unless directed otherwise.

Frequently asked questions

How long does Xanax take to work?+
Effects are typically felt within 30 to 60 minutes after oral administration, depending on individual metabolism and stomach contents.
Can I drive after taking Xanax?+
Xanax may cause drowsiness or dizziness; avoid driving or operating machinery until you know how it affects you.
Is Xanax safe for long-term use?+
Long-term use should only occur under direct medical supervision due to risks of dependence and tolerance.
What should I avoid while taking Xanax?+
Avoid alcohol, grapefruit, and other sedatives unless approved by your healthcare provider.
Can I buy Xanax online without a prescription?+
No, Xanax is a controlled substance and requires a valid prescription from a licensed healthcare provider.
